과정 세부사항

• Fundamentals of Nanostructure Manufacturing: An introduction to the basics of nanostructure manufacturing, including essential concepts, methods, and tools.
• Nanomaterials and their Properties: A deep dive into various nanomaterials, their properties, and potential applications in high-performance manufacturing.
• Synthesis Techniques for Nanostructures: Exploration of various synthesis techniques, including top-down and bottom-up approaches, for manufacturing nanostructures.
• Nanofabrication Techniques: Advanced fabrication techniques for creating and manipulating nanostructures, including lithography, etching, and self-assembly.
• Characterization Techniques for Nanostructures: Examination of various characterization techniques for analyzing nanostructures, such as electron microscopy, spectroscopy, and scattering techniques.
• Design and Simulation of Nanostructures: Utilization of advanced design and simulation tools to predict and optimize the performance of nanostructures.
• Quality Control and Reliability in Nanostructure Manufacturing: Implementation of quality control measures and reliability testing to ensure consistent and high-performance manufacturing.
• Industrial Applications of Nanostructure Manufacturing: An overview of the various industrial applications of nanostructure manufacturing, including electronics, energy, and healthcare.
• Ethics and Environmental Considerations in Nanostructure Manufacturing: Examination of the ethical and environmental implications of nanostructure manufacturing, including safety, sustainability, and regulations.
